Microsoft Elevate America
Microsoft has made a corporate commitment to strengthen the U.S. economy and increase global {Photo of man using a laptop computer} competitiveness by improving access to education and workforce-readiness skills required for twenty-first-century jobs.
To support this commitment, Microsoft launched Elevate America, an initiative designed to provide 1 million vouchers for Microsoft E-Learning courses and select Microsoft Certification exams at no cost to recipients. Elevate America will be implemented in cooperation with states across the country as part of the company's overall effort to help train two million people over the next three years.
The Kalamazoo-St Joseph County Michigan WORKS! Agency is implementing Elevate America for residents of Kalamazoo and St Joseph counties. This is a self directed initiative for residents to use free vouchers to upgrade their technology skills or certifications via Microsoft online trainings and Microsoft business exams. Note: You must have a functioning email address/account to participate.
